Obituary Brenda Carol Hill

Brenda Carol Hill, affectionately known as Mimmie, went home to Jesus on March 29, 2021 at the age of 66. 

Born in Newport News, VA, Brenda was raised by her mother, Margaret Clevenger and moved at a young age to Aberdeen, NC.  She attended Pinecrest High School and graduated in 1973 with a license in cosmetology.  Brenda had a very successful career and enjoyed spending time with her loyal clients throughout the years.  Many of her clients became lifelong friends.

Brenda was blessed with a son, Jay Hill.  He was her pride and joy until her very last day earthside.  In addition to her son, she had a very special relationship with her extended family, spoiling her sisters and nieces at every opportunity. 

After her sister’s passing in 2013, she stood in as a surrogate mother to her nieces, Traci and Sydni.  She loved them as her very own.

Brenda joins her mother and sister, Teresa (Teri) Cameron, in Heaven. She is survived by her son and two sisters:  Wanda King (Sam) of Prosperity, SC and Cathy Yonish (Ken) of Whispering Pines, NC.  She is also survived by nieces Erin Brady, Karin Yonish, Lesley Jones, Ashley Barber, Traci Cameron and Sydni Cameron along with great nieces and nephews: Kelsey, Kameron, Reese, Kaleb, Nate, Easton, Colten, Carter and Evelyn.
